Bezel vs Prong Settings: Which Diamond Setting Is Best?

When choosing a diamond ring, the setting plays an important role in both appearance and durability. Two of the most common settings are bezel and prong settings.

Understanding the differences can help you select the best option for your lifestyle.

What Is a Prong Setting?

Prong settings hold the diamond using small metal claws that allow more light to enter the stone. This design maximizes sparkle and is one of the most traditional engagement ring styles.

What Is a Bezel Setting?

A bezel setting surrounds the diamond with a thin rim of metal. This creates a modern look while providing extra protection for the stone.

Durability

Bezel settings offer additional security because the diamond is fully surrounded by metal. Prong settings expose more of the stone but still provide excellent durability when crafted properly.

Style Considerations

Prong settings tend to look more classic and delicate, while bezel settings often appear sleek and contemporary.

FAQs

Are lab-grown diamonds real diamonds?

Yes. Lab-grown diamonds have the same chemical composition, crystal structure, and brilliance as natural diamonds. The only difference is how they are formed.

How do I choose the right engagement ring?

Choosing an engagement ring involves considering diamond shape, size, setting style, and budget. Many couples today choose lab-grown diamonds because they offer excellent quality at a more accessible price.

What is the difference between fine jewelry and fashion jewelry?

Fine jewelry is made with precious metals such as solid gold and genuine gemstones, while fashion jewelry typically uses plated metals and simulated stones.
